Khanatist
An album with such a sad aura that I steered clear of it for quite a while. How any Kozelek fan could be disappointed by this is beyond me. The sometimes near lethargically depressed vocals are wonderfully accompanied by Lavalle's folktronica; the songs take just as much time as they need. It's a real treat to hear these gems go on for 6-8 minutes, and when the album closer fades out after more than 10 minutes, you're already craving for more. Slowcore's veteran did it again.
